Polimex - Mostostal's Total Stockholders Equity for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was zł754 Mil. It refers to the net assets owned by shareholders. It does not include minority interest.

Total Stockholders Equity is used to calculate Book Value per Share. Polimex - Mostostal's Book Value per Share for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was zł2.95. The ratio of a company's debt over equity can be used to measure how leveraged this company is. Polimex - Mostostal's Debt-to-Equity for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 0.14.

Polimex - Mostostal Business Description

Other Exchanges 7F7:Germany
Address Ul. Czackiego 15/17, P.O. Box skr. poczt. 815, Warszawa, POL, 00-950
Polimex - Mostostal SA is a Poland based engineering and construction company. It provides services in the industrial construction sector including the general contractor's basis for the chemical, refinery and petrochemical industries, power engineering, and environmental protection, among others. Its offerings include production plants, logistics centers, commercial centers, and warehouses.
